The Anker Prime Charger is a 100W GaN charger featuring 3 ports (2 USB-C, 1 USB-A) that deliver rapid charging for multiple devices simultaneously. Its foldable prongs and compact design make it perfect for professionals on the move, while thicker prongs and a drop-proof structure ensure reliable connections. Compatible with the latest MacBook, iPhone 17 series, Galaxy S24, and more, it’s ClimatePartner certified for sustainable charging.

A hot little beast of a charging tool!
This little charging block is a beast! It is surprisingly small but very heavy for its size and paired with an appropriately rated cord will make short work of your charging needs. I have several beefy Anker Prime power bricks that are a whisper under 100 watt hours that are my go to for charging when traveling, on the go, or even at home when outlets are lacking. This little gem recharges them in no time.The plug prongs retract into the housing to keep them protected, and the blades are much thicker than usual which supports the heft of the charger easily. Two USB C ports can power things simultaneously and the charging will limit to what is safe for the device. I charged camping fans and output was a max of 5v which is what the fans can handle. Plug in a tablet or laptop and fast charging kicks in. The USB A port is great for backwards compatibility. The small form factor is perfect for a purse or carry on luggage and replaces much bulkier OEM chargers with transformers.My only concern is that it gets HOT in use, so hot that I needed hand protection to unplug it without burning myself. Because of this I don't dare leave it plugged into a wall, nor leave it unattended whilst charging items. I worry about fire hazard. It has been a half hour since I finished charging my Anker Prime brick from 53% to full ( that took 26 minutes!) and it is still extremely warm to touch despite being unplugged as soon as charging was complete. I'm going to try my next charge with the second C port to see if that mitigates the heat build up. For the record, the cables I am using are rated for 100 and 230 watts respectively and are not cheap knock offs. This would be 5 stars or even 10 if the heat issue were not so extreme.
